871 (defun spam-backend-check (backend)
872 "Get the check function for BACKEND.
873 Each individual check may return nil, t, or a mailgroup name.
874 The value nil means that the check does not yield a decision, and
875 so, that further checks are needed. The value t means that the
876 message is definitely not spam, and that further spam checks
877 should be inhibited. Otherwise, a mailgroup name or the symbol
878 'spam (depending on `spam-split-symbolic-return') is returned where
879 the mail should go, and further checks are also inhibited. The
880 usual mailgroup name is the value of `spam-split-group', meaning
881 that the message is definitely a spam."
882 (get backend 'check))

1617 (defun spam-split (&rest specific-checks)
1618 "Split this message into the `spam' group if it is spam.
1619 This function can be used as an entry in the variable `nnmail-split-fancy',
1620 for example like this: (: spam-split). It can take checks as
1621 parameters. A string as a parameter will set the
1622 `spam-split-group' to that string.
1624 See the Info node `(gnus)Fancy Mail Splitting' for more details."
1625 (interactive)
1626 (setq spam-split-last-successful-check nil)
1627 (unless spam-split-disabled
1628 (let ((spam-split-group-choice spam-split-group))
1629 (dolist (check specific-checks)
1630 (when (stringp check)
1631 (setq spam-split-group-choice check)
1632 (setq specific-checks (delq check specific-checks))))
1634 (let ((spam-split-group spam-split-group-choice)
1635 (widening-needed-check (spam-widening-needed-p specific-checks)))
1636 (save-excursion
1637 (save-restriction
1638 (when widening-needed-check
1639 (widen)
1640 (gnus-message 8 "spam-split: widening the buffer (%s requires it)"
1641 widening-needed-check))
1642 (let ((backends (spam-backend-list))
1643 decision)
1644 (while (and backends (not decision))
1645 (let* ((backend (pop backends))
1646 (check-function (spam-backend-check backend))
1647 (spam-split-group (if spam-split-symbolic-return
1648 'spam
1649 spam-split-group)))
1650 (when (or
1651 ;; either, given specific checks, this is one of them
1652 (memq backend specific-checks)
1653 ;; or, given no specific checks, spam-use-CHECK is set
1654 (and (null specific-checks) (symbol-value backend)))
1655 (gnus-message 6 "spam-split: calling the %s function"
1656 check-function)
1657 (setq decision (funcall check-function))
1658 ;; if we got a decision at all, save the current check
1659 (when decision
1660 (setq spam-split-last-successful-check backend))
1662 (when (eq decision 'spam)
1663 (unless spam-split-symbolic-return
1664 (gnus-error
1666 (format "spam-split got %s but %s is nil"
1667 decision
1668 spam-split-symbolic-return)))))))
1669 (if (eq decision t)
1670 (if spam-split-symbolic-return-positive 'ham nil)
1671 decision))))))))

2010 (defun spam-check-blackholes ()
2011 "Check the Received headers for blackholed relays."
2012 (let ((headers (message-fetch-field "received"))
2013 ips matches)
2014 (when headers
2015 (with-temp-buffer
2016 (insert headers)
2017 (goto-char (point-min))
2018 (gnus-message 6 "Checking headers for relay addresses")
2019 (while (re-search-forward
2020 "\\([0-9]+\\.[0-9]+\\.[0-9]+\\.[0-9]+\\)" nil t)
2021 (gnus-message 9 "Blackhole search found host IP %s." (match-string 1))
2022 (push (spam-reverse-ip-string (match-string 1))
2023 ips)))
2024 (dolist (server spam-blackhole-servers)
2025 (dolist (ip ips)
2026 (unless (and spam-blackhole-good-server-regex
2027 ;; match the good-server-regex against the reversed (again) IP string
2028 (string-match
2029 spam-blackhole-good-server-regex
2030 (spam-reverse-ip-string ip)))
2031 (unless matches
2032 (let ((query-string (concat ip "." server)))
2033 (if spam-use-dig
2034 (let ((query-result (query-dig query-string)))
2035 (when query-result
2036 (gnus-message 6 "(DIG): positive blackhole check '%s'"
2037 query-result)
2038 (push (list ip server query-result)
2039 matches)))
2040 ;; else, if not using dig.el
2041 (when (dns-query query-string)
2042 (gnus-message 6 "positive blackhole check")
2043 (push (list ip server (dns-query query-string 'TXT))
2044 matches)))))))))
2045 (when matches
2046 spam-split-group)))

2678 (defun spam-spamassassin-register-with-sa-learn (articles spam
2679 &optional unregister)
2680 "Register articles with spamassassin's sa-learn as spam or non-spam."
2681 (if articles
2682 (let ((action (if unregister spam-sa-learn-unregister-switch
2683 (if spam spam-sa-learn-spam-switch
2684 spam-sa-learn-ham-switch)))
2685 (summary-buffer-name (buffer-name)))
2686 (with-temp-buffer
2687 ;; group the articles into mbox format
2688 (dolist (article articles)
2689 (let (article-string)
2690 (with-current-buffer summary-buffer-name
2691 (setq article-string (spam-get-article-as-string article)))
2692 (when (stringp article-string)
2693 (insert "From \n") ; mbox separator (sa-learn only checks the
2694 ; first five chars, so we can get away with
2695 ; a bogus line))
2696 (insert article-string)
2697 (insert "\n"))))
2698 ;; call sa-learn on all messages at the same time
2699 (apply 'call-process-region
2700 (point-min) (point-max)
2701 spam-sa-learn-program
2702 nil nil nil "--mbox"
2703 (if spam-sa-learn-rebuild
2704 (list action)
2705 `("--no-rebuild" ,action)))))))
